About The Position

The Manufacturing Process Engineer will be responsible for identifying opportunities to improve our manufacturing processes and implementing appropriate improvements to the manufacturing process. The position will require approximately 50% of the engineer's time spent in the manufacturing environment evaluating and troubleshooting key issues to drive performance.
